摘要
MicroRNAs (miR) are a class of non-coding endogenous RNA molecules that suppress the translation of protein-coding genes by destabilizing target mRNAs. The MiR-574-5p has been reported to be involved in the several types of cancer. However, the expression of miR-574-5p and its mechanism in nasopharyngeal carcinoma (NPC) remain unclear. We found that the expression level of miR-574-5p was significantly increased in the NPC cell lines. We further demonstrated that Forkhead box N3 (FOXN3) was a target gene of miR-574-5p. FOXN3 overexpression and inhibition reversed the promoting or suppressing effect, respectively, of NPC cell proliferation, migration and invasion caused by miR-574-5p. Furthermore, miR-574-5p enhanced the beta-catenin and TCF4 protein expression by repressing FOXN3 expression, resulting in the activation of the Wnt/beta-catenin signaling pathway, but the activity of the Wnt/beta-catenin signaling pathway was inhibited by a miR-574-5p inhibitor or FOXN3 overexpression, which reversed the effect of miR-574-5p. Wound-healing and Transwell assays also showed that miR-574-5p promotes the cell migration and invasion of NPC cells, whereas the promoting effect of miR-574-5p was also reversed by a miR-574-5p inhibitor or FOXN3 overexpression. Collectively, these data suggested that miR-574-5p promotes NPC cell proliferation, migration, and invasion at least partly by targeting the FOXN3/Wnt/beta-Catenin signaling pathway.
